Boric acid comes as a white powder and mainly works by dehydrating the larvae after being consumed. As fleas’ primary diet source is blood, they aren’t boric acid’s primary target. For this reason, these products usually mix boric acid with other natural or chemical compounds. Because of their popularity, these carpet powders are readily available in most pet stores. Flea life cycles can last for up to 30 days, so you’ll want the flea powder that you choose to last for at least the same period, or you’ll need to reapply. Many chemical flea powders can last far longer than this —up to a year, in some cases — but herbal flea powders usually work for most of the life cycle of fleas. Ideally, you’ll want to use a flea powder that can be used topically on your carpets and bedding, as this is far more effective overall. If you use powder that can be used only on flooring or carpets, the fleas living on your cat may outlive the powder on your floors, perpetuating the life cycle. Diatomaceous earth is a common ingredient because it is safe for pets and children, good for the environment, can be used on carpets and bedding and topically, and is safe and even beneficial when ingested. Diatomaceous earth is made from the fossilized remains of tiny aquatic organisms and is free from any chemicals or additives. When applying the flea power to carpets make sure that you don’t apply too much at once; this will prevent clumping and help avoid over-saturation of carpets in heavily infested areas. When in doubt about how much to use, it’s best to start out with a light application and repeat as needed if your flea problem does not clear up after initial treatment. Research And just as important as vacuuming, you want to empty the vacuum after cleaning immediately to avoid a reinfestation. If your vacuum has a bag, step outside, remove the bag, and place it in something that can be sealed, like a container or another type of bag. Then put it in your outside garbage can.
